Abstract

The invention discloses a kind of pcb boards to go up panel device automatically, it is characterized by comprising frame bodies, center is provided with elevator station in the frame body, hopper elevator is provided on the elevator station, it is located above hopper elevator in the frame body and is provided with machine arm device and camera arrangement, the front end of the hopper elevator is provided with the double-deck hopper pipeline, the rear end of the hopper elevator is provided with pcb board pipeline, the rear end of the pcb board pipeline is also connected with pcb board special equipment, the double-deck hopper pipeline includes the inlet pipeline on upper layer and the outlet pipeline of lower layer, full plate case enters to elevator station from inlet pipeline, after carrying out identification positioning by camera arrangement, machine arm device successively grabs the pcb board in hopper into pcb board pipeline , the features such as which has pcb board automatic positioning, identification, and upper Board position plans automatically, and sucker is adjusted without manual intervention.

Background technique
It is cleaned after PCB forming, the processes such as OSP and detection, these process links, pcb board upper plate are equal at present For artificial upper plate or simple device upper plate, situations such as that there are upper plates is irregular for artificial upper plate, low efficiency, existing upper panel device exists It is unable to automatic identification plate size and need to manually put adjustment, sucker adjusts that complicated, manual intervention is more, snap-gauge and board falling failure rate height etc. Situation needs to design and develop panel device on new PCB for these problems.

A kind of pcb board of the present invention as depicted in figs. 1 and 2 goes up the embodiment of panel device, including frame body 1 automatically, described Frame body 1 in center be provided with elevator station, hopper elevator 2, the frame are provided on the elevator station Top in frame body 1 positioned at hopper elevator 2 is provided with machine arm device and camera arrangement, before the hopper elevator 2 End is provided with the double-deck hopper pipeline, and the rear end of the hopper elevator 2 is provided with pcb board pipeline 3, the pcb board The rear end of pipeline 3 is also connected with pcb board special equipment 4, and the double-deck hopper pipeline includes the inlet pipeline 5 on upper layer Elevator station is entered to from inlet pipeline 5 with the hopper 7 of the outlet pipeline 6 of lower layer, full plate, is carried out by camera arrangement After identification positioning, machine arm device successively grabs the pcb board in hopper 7 into pcb board pipeline 3;The machine arm device packet The mechanical hand 8 that suspension is mounted in the frame body 1 is included, the end of the mechanical hand 8 is provided with that pcb board can be adsorbed and grabs Sucker 9, realize crawl to pcb board using negative pressure of vacuum, execution unit is put in pcb board crawl, automatic according to pcb board size Calculate pcb board arrangement information;The camera arrangement includes the light source 10 and camera 11 being installed on the frame body 1, institute The camera 11 stated is located at the surface of elevator station, and by taking pictures to full plate case 7, pcb board is outer in identification hopper 7 Shape size, and identification positioning (posture informations such as position, corner including pcb board) are carried out to pcb board;The hopper 7 is by dividing The outline border and inner bottom plating composition, elevator of body formula design withstand outer container when inner bottom plating moves up and down and remain stationary;The frame Control cabinet and operation panel are also equipped on body 1.
Working principle: the hopper 7 for filling pcb board enters from inlet pipeline 5;Inlet pipeline 5 conveys full plate case 7 To hopper elevator station;Camera 11 takes pictures to the hopper 7 of full plate, gets the outer dimension of pcb board and position in hopper Confidence breath, and the information is transmitted to machine arm device;Machine arm device is distributed automatically according to pcb board outer dimension information and is put The distributed intelligence of pcb board;Machine arm device grabs pcb board according to pcb board location information, and according to point calculated automatically Cloth information arranges to PCB, and pcb board is placed on pcb board pipeline 3;Pcb board pipeline 3 and subsequent pcb board are dedicated Equipment 4 is connected, to realize the function in hopper 7 on pcb board automatic upper plate to pcb board special equipment 4;In full plate case 7 Pcb board has often grabbed one layer, and 7 inner bottom plating of hopper is risen certain distance together with pcb board by elevator together, and (hopper outline border position is not It is dynamic), to keep machine arm device suction disc height and position from hopper constant;Above-mentioned movement is recycled, until in full plate case 7 Pcb board is caught away completely;Then hopper 7 at this time is empty charging box, and empty charging box is gradually lowered under the action of hopper elevator 2 The height of discharging transmission line, and empty charging box is transported on outlet pipeline 6;Outlet pipeline 6 transports out empty charging box.
